Output f72bde5b28f5ada761a931094a573e04b213cb35667d93f2eac9894e7119efc4:2

value
145217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67d699351201ef0f61b0aff1b1068472ae434ecd OP_EQUAL
address
3BA4bs8USnSZuRWo833nbAbafptVfrFpLX
transaction
f72bde5b28f5ada761a931094a573e04b213cb35667d93f2eac9894e7119efc4
confirmations
261413
spent
true